TRNO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

172 of the 4,373 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Terreno Realty (TRNO)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$1.93B — down 0.46% from $1.94B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 24 funds closed out of TRNO and 21 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 58 trimmed existing stakes and 67 added.

The largest buyer was Invesco, adding an estimated $39.9M. The largest seller was BlackRock, cutting an estimated $23.8M.
